Compliance Analyst (Banking), Sr. jobs in Alabama

Compliance Analyst (Banking), Sr. monitors customer accounts and researches transactions to identify suspicious activity violating current anti-money laundering (AML) regulations defined in the US Bank Secrecy Act (BSA) or other governmental anti-terrorist financing programs. Uses customer data mining and software tools to identify suspicious activity patterns. Being a Compliance Analyst (Banking), Sr. reviews daily Currency Transaction Reports (CTR) and Questionable Activity Reports (QAR), and submits Suspicious Activity Reports (SAR) as appropriate. Ensures adherence to Know your Customer (KYC) protocols. Additionally, Compliance Analyst (Banking), Sr. may lead or participate in investigations of suspicious activity to pursue corrective actions and ensure completion of required filings. Keeps abreast with regulatory changes, risk management best practices, and trending methods used by fraud perpetrators. Delivers compliance training with up-to-date regulatory information and procedures to develop and guide a well-informed staff. Typically requires a bachelor's degree. May have the Certified Anti Money Laundering Specialist (CAMS) certification. Typically reports to a manager. The Compliance Analyst (Banking), Sr. occasionally directed in several aspects of the work. Gaining exposure to some of the complex tasks within the job function. To be a Compliance Analyst (Banking), Sr. typically requires 2 -4 years of related experience. (Copyright 2024 Salary.com)

    Summary
    The Compliance Analyst assists in completing Compliance program related activities. Is responsible for Compliance Hotline management, project monitoring, data analysis, report creation, supporting the Compliance Work Plan, and reviewing performance measures for the Compliance program. Collaborates with staff across Sevita to support general Compliance activities.

    This position is remote and can be performed from anywhere in the U.S. There is some travel required.


    • Manage the day-to-day operations of the Company’s Compliance Hotline, including report review, report assignment, active monitoring to ensure that all reports are tracked, investigated and appropriate action is taken to resolve the concern. Coordinates cross-functionally across the Company with internal teams. Maintains utmost confidentiality regarding the Compliance Hotline; reports raised; and outcomes of investigations.
    • Responsible for trending data to identify patterns, trends, and actual/potential risks for mitigation by the Company’s Management Compliance Committee and other internal forums.
    • Assists with ongoing maintenance and reporting of Compliance Hotline data, Compliance training, and sanction screening.
    • Conducts and evaluates research of laws, regulations, guidelines, contracts, policies/procedures and other resources to effectively perform position responsibilities.
    • Utilizes tools such as Excel PowerPoint and PowerBI in conjunction with platforms including Onspring and Navex to develop and maintain data.
    • Completes projects designed to measure business compliance with certain regulatory or contractual requirements, which includes monitoring monthly exclusion reports for sanctions and assisting with audits.
    • Employs analytical skills to effectively produce reports, assess risk, interpret data narratives, articulate findings and provide appropriate recommendations.
    • Develops the skill set to perform Compliance investigations.
    • Assists with Compliance investigations as needed by providing data, reviewing reports, updating records and/or performing other duties.
    • Collaborates with the Compliance team to conduct Compliance Hotline investigation training and education sessions periodically or as needed.
    • Troubleshoots technical issues and answers questions regarding the Compliance Hotline platforms.
    • Collaborates with internal and external personnel to implement process and platform improvements, including testing technical updates.
    • Projects a mature, professional image and provide responsive, meaningful, high-quality follow up to internal and external communications.
    • Performs other duties as assigned.

Alabama (/ˌæləˈbæmə/) is a state in the southeastern region of the United States. It is bordered by Tennessee to the north, Georgia to the east, Florida and the Gulf of Mexico to the south, and Mississippi to the west. Alabama is the 30th largest by area and the 24th-most populous of the U.S. states. With a total of 1,500 miles (2,400 km) of inland waterways, Alabama has among the most of any state. Alabama is nicknamed the Yellowhammer State, after the state bird. Alabama is also known as the "Heart of Dixie" and the "Cotton State".
